Tiverton Rugby Club is a rugby union club based in the town of Tiverton, Devon, England. The club plays at Coronation Field, and as of the 2024–25 season competes in the level six Regional 2 South West league and the Devon Intermediate Cup. It is considered to be the oldest rugby club in Devon.

Sarah French Russell is an American lawyer and academic who serves as a United States district judge of the United States District Court for the District of Connecticut.
